#2e412c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2e412c is composed of 18% red, 25.5% green and 17.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 29.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 32.3% yellow and 74.5% black. It has a hue angle of 114.3 degrees, a saturation of 19.3% and a lightness of 21.4%. #2e412c color hex could be obtained by blending #5c8258 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333333.

Shades and Tints of #2e412c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050704 is the darkest color, while #fafbfa is the lightest one.
